- What is NOVA, Inc.'s rental — revenue?
- NOVA, Inc. (NOV) reported rental — revenue of $240.75M in Q4 2025.
- How has NOVA, Inc.'s rental — revenue changed year-over-year?
- NOVA, Inc.'s rental — revenue decreased by 8.2% year-over-year, from $262.25M to $240.75M.
- What is the long-term trend for NOVA, Inc.'s rental — revenue?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), NOVA, Inc.'s rental — revenue has grown at a 10.7%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$641M to $963M.
- What does rental — revenue mean?
- This metric represents the total gross income generated from the rental of equipment and related services within the specified business segment, excluding any pass-through taxes. It serves as a primary indicator of market demand and the scale of the company's rental operations. Tracking this revenue helps investors assess the segment's ability to monetize its asset base and maintain competitive positioning in the rental market.
